Transaction 81b751ac0318f92c9737b36bf2dd13820c3905c71f5729f9a01cc3ea17486f8a
1 Input
1 Output
-
81b751ac0318f92c9737b36bf2dd13820c3905c71f5729f9a01cc3ea17486f8a:0
- value
- 21681083
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 e7ad691c4f96a50ad98f6748244e4afb7c3d6871 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1N7zq6Ka4hS11kQReQr9bmmPg8ePnR9Uen